What is weathering? 

When rocks get broken down by wind, rain, ice, and temperature changes.

What is an igneous rock and how is it formed? 

Igneous rocks are "fire formed" rocks, made from cool lava or magma.

What is a metamorphic Rock and how is it formed?

Metamorphic rocks are 'changed' rocks deep in the earth. They are changed by heat and/or pressure.

What is a sedimentary rock and how is it formed? 

Sedimentary rocks are formed by pressure compacting and cementing sediments together. Sediments form layers on the bottom of streams and rivers and the weight of the water pushes on the layers compacting them together.

What are 6 ways to identify minerals? 

1. Colour (what colour is the mineral?) 

2. Texture (the way it feels)

3. Patterns/shapes (what do you see?)

4. Hardness Test (is it soft? can you scratch it with your finger?) 

5. Lustre (how does it reflect light, is it shiny, dull?)

6. Streak Test (what colour is the streak?)

What is the difference between extrusive igneous rock and intrusive igneous rock? 

Extrusive rocks are formed on the surface of the Earth  Intrusive rocks are formed within the crust of the planet.
